BUT there is a workaround...
Reset one of your mouse buttons to a keyboard key (let's say "b").
Now, if you hit "b" and the other mouse button at the same time, you can dual cast. You still need to time it right, however, but it did work for me.

1) Open you magic menu and go to the spell you wish to dual cast.
2) While hovering over the spell with your mouse, press the left and right mouse buttons at the same time. (You should see a "LR" appear next to the spell)
3) When casting press both mouse buttons simultaneously to use both hands to cast a single fire ball. Press each mouse button down at different times to cast two separate fire balls at the same time.
